MiguelPurizaca - PeerSpot reviewer
Focus on seamless integration and advanced security management enhances application usage and threat detection across multiple countries
Okta Customer Identity focuses on providing top-notch identity management solutions. One of its most valuable features is its easy integration with various applications through its extensive application directory, offering hundreds or thousands of applications ready to configure. This integration is significantly easier compared to Microsoft Entra ID, where we encountered numerous issues. We particularly value its real-time reporting capabilities. For example, we detected cyberattacks from countries like Russia and Asia and were able to block those IP addresses and configure our system for more security. These advanced security features and reporting capabilities make it easy to manage.
Ritesh_Shah - PeerSpot reviewer
Utilizing key management and seamless single sign-on integration for enhanced user profile management
WSO2 Identity Server's key management feature stands out as a particularly impactful feature for enhancing security. Additionally, from a user perspective, the self-user portal and user profile management capabilities are highly valuable. It allows users to manage their profiles, change passwords, and offers a self-care portal type of functionality. The single sign-on capability integrates seamlessly with various platforms, including Google, Facebook, LDAP, and Active Directory, which supports rapid product launches.

Cons

"Okta has a limitation with directory integrations. If you have multiple Active Directory integrations, the user distinguished name (DN) and the manager DN don't get imported properly into the Okta user profile."
"The integration process takes a bit longer than we would want it to."
"I would like to see the provisioning simplified."
"Users sometimes have difficulty getting verification codes."
"Some limitations in scalability. Each application we work with can be completely different, resulting in highly variable implementation processes."
"The product must be provided for free."
"There is an access request system that is very limited access to the systems available for end-users. The access request should improve in Okta Customer Identity."
"In Okta Identity Governance and Okta Privileged Access, some features are still being developed. Integration with Active Directory servers, Cisco routers, and switches is not currently available."
"The high availability architecture has to be improved."
"The solution could improve its development from a user perspective."
"I found the initial setup to be very complex."
"The solution seems to be pretty outdated."
"Sometimes working with the code is difficult because I search for documentation about the code and how to work with the code, which is where I believe they should improve, by providing some documentation on how to work with the code."
"There needs to be a good support model and easy-to-understand documentation."
"The solution's licensing model could be more flexible, and pricing could be improved."
"The price of the product is an area of concern where improvements are required."
